Abstract
In a pressure sensitive adhesive label sheet stock in which the pressure sensitive adhesive layer (applied to a paper substrate) employs a normally non-tacky elastomer, such as natural or artificial rubber, and a normally tacky resin, such as an hydrogenated rosin ester, the improvement of replacing part but not all of the elastomer with a polyurethane elastomer, which has been cured on the substrate, as part of the elastomer system. The polyurethane elastomer is formed from an organic polyol and an organic diisocyanate, which are present, as such, in the pressure sensitive adhesive coating composition when it is applied to the paper substrate. The polyol and diisocyanate are cured by heat while applied to the substrate during drying of the coating composition.

2. Pressure sensitive adhesive label sheet stock according to claim 1, said polyurethane and said one or more elastomer components together comprising between 30% and 70% by weight of the pressure sensitive adhesive, said tackifying resin comprising between 30% and 70% by weight of the pressure sensitive adhesive and said polyurethane comprising between 10% and 90% by weight of the elastomer base.
-
3. Pressure sensitive adhesive label sheet stock according to claim 1, said synthetic rubber being selected from the group consisting of styrene-butadiene copolymer, butadiene-acrylonitrile copolymer, butadiene-styrene-acrylonitrile copolymer, polyisoprene, isopolybutadiene, polyisobutylene, ethylene-propylene terpolymer, acrylic resin, poly-vinyl ethers, and butyl rubber.
-
4. Pressure sensitive adhesive label sheet stock according to claim 1, said tackifying resin being selected from the group consisting of hydrogenated rosin esters, coumarone-indene resins, unsaturated aliphatic hydrocarbons, polyterpene, polyisobutylene, phenylated terpene and petroleum resins.
-
5. Pressure sensitive label sheet stock according to claim 1, said polyurethane being the polyurethane of a polyisocyanate and an organic polyol polymer having an elastomeric-imparting, repeating backbone structure derived from olefinic polymerization.
-
6. Pressure sensitive adhesive label sheet stock according to claim 5, said polyol polymer being a hydroxy-terminated diene polymer.
-
7. Pressure sensitive adhesive label sheet stock according to claim 6, said hydroxy-terminated diene polymer being selected from the group consisting of butadiene homopolymer, butadiene-acrylonitrile copolymer, butadiene-styrene copolymer, butadiene-styrene-acrylonitrile copolymer and mixtures thereof.
-
8. Pressure sensitive adhesive label sheet stock according to claim 1, said polyurethane being the polyurethane of a diisocyanate and an organic polyol polymer having an elastomeric-imparting, repeating backbone structure which is substantially the same as the elastomeric-imparting, repeating backbone structure of at least one of said one or more elastomers.
-
9. Pressure sensitive adhesive label sheet stock according to claim 8, said polyol polymer being a polyol butadiene polymer and said one or more elastomers including a butadiene polymer.
-
10. Pressure sensitive adhesive label sheet stock according to claim 1, said polyurethane being a polyurethane of a diisocyanate and a polyol butadiene polymer and another modifying polyol selected from the group consisting of a non-polymeric diol and a triol to promote hydrogen bonding.
-
